HomeMy WebLinkAbout1975-05-15 MinutesMINUTES OF A PLAT REVIEW COMMITTEE MEETING
A meeting of the Fayetteville Plat Review- Committee was held at 9:10 A. M.
Thursday, May 15, 1975, in the Board .of Directors Room, City Administration
Building, Fayetteville, Arkansas.
UTILITY REPRESENTATIVES PRESENT: Randy Schneider, Floyd Hornaday*, Jack Whitting,
Roy Hawkins, Clyde Terry.
CITY REPRESENTATIVES PRESENT: Bobbie Jones, Janet Bowen.
OTHERS PRESENT: Larry Gage.
REVISION OF EASEMENTS
The only item for discussion was the revision of Northwest Arkansas -Plaza
the easements at the Northwest Arkansas Plaza Mall. Larry Gage, Manager of the
Mall, was present to represent. Comments were as follows:
1. Roy Hawkins (Southwestern Bell Telephone): Our existing cable is now on
the North side of the first access road in the flower garden median; our cable
runs exactly 4 foot off the curb running straight up that section to this
easement on the East side of the building. We would like to have that entire
Np section of flower garden median shown North of the double drive as a utility
easement extending to the easement._ The easements asked for cover everything
except for the one easement. After looking over Mr. Whitting's plans,Mr. Hawkins
said he needed a 20 foot easement running on the North side of the North entrance
road to the Mall and follow it along the West line along the top of the bank
l)! just outside the curb and fence.

2. Jack Whitting (Ozarks Electric): Right after the Mall was completed, we
ran.a survey on where our lines were buried containing magnetic bearings
'1' also distances, and angles and we never did have any easements sent back to us.
it
They had this on file up in their office and we made a copy of it here and I
outlined where the cable runs in red. I would like to submit this to show where
we would like to have our easements. It would be better than trying to describe
verbally. Mr. Whitting said he would be glad to supply the Planning Office a copy
of this. Mr. Whitting said they would be coming from the West along the same
line and break Northward along the West line of the Shoneys' site.
Planning Administrator Bobbie Jones explained that she understood that Shoneys
was having to shift their building site because of a sewer problem.
Roy Hawkins (Southwestern Bell Telephone): We can leave this easement along
Shoneys! West line until after the Shoneys' property comes in.
3. Randy Schneider and Frank Hornaday (SWEPCO): We don't serve anything in
here yet. But all this to the West we will serve since it does fall.under our
territory. We need a IS foot easement along the West line (Call N 0 degrees.
36'00" W 626.13) to get in there from the Northwest corner of the extreme North
portion of the property to wherever the future retail building is.
They discussed who owned the rectangle of property to the West of this.
Planning Administrator Bobbie Jones said they did not own it at first but that
they could have purchased it since.
Mr. Hornaday: Since we do not have a layout on the building yet we can't
think about an easement through there (past the location of the future retail
building.)

4. Clyde Terry (Warner Cable): I believe they have covered what I need because
we are with. the telephone company going in. However, where the telephone left off
behind Sears we go all the ivay down to the GMAC offices. It would be under the
street (drives). I think we are within that 20 foot easement shown. We need
a 20 foot easement along the South property line, West property line; and short
North side of the property line (call N86 degrees 26' 00" E 208.7').
5. Bobbie Jones (Planning Administrator). You might want to consider the
possibility of making these blocks (Block 1,2, and 3) and then later on if any
additional easements were granted in this it would only have to be worded
Block 3 of the plat and only describe this and not have to worry with the
descriptions of the complete plot. That could put the original Mall construction
under one block and Sambo and property behind it another block; a replat of this would
only have to deal with one block. This could not be broken up into other tracts
without a public street.
The ordinance limits the size of plats to 18 x 23, or it has to be waived by the
Planning Commission. Before the mylars (either size) are made up I would like to
have that question posed to the Planning Commission to see if they will accept that
and I will also check with the courthouse to see if they can handle a plat this size.
This does not need to be any smaller printing on the certificates.
You need to either have 1" = 100' or 1"= 200'.
We received a metes and bounds description for the Frontage Road and I have
a little difficulty getting it to align with the earlier plans submitted on the
Frontage Road. What do they intend between the Frontage Road and the highway?
There will be a strip approximately 100 feet wide between the Frontage Road description
and the highway as they have it shown. It might be that the two rights-of-way have
joint boundaries or adjacent to each other: I don't think they can (or do plan to)
use it for building purposes. They will just be paying taxes on property that is
being unused.
Larry Gage: I don't know. You can contact Max Hall Engineering Services. in
Springdale since he has worked with the utility easements and the Frontage Road.
Roy Hawkins (Southwestern Bell Telephone) commented that the street right-of-way
stakes are within 2 foot of the road all the way through.
Bobbie Jones: I platted out the descriptions of the Frontage Road and in cases
they did not mesh. I sent them back to the City Attorney and asked him to request
a surveyor's or engineer's certification on them if they were correct and I have not
heard anymore from them.They have wanted to do the Frontage Road by deed rather
than putting it on the plat. Itwould give us a clearer picture if it was all on
there together.
Comments from the Street Department, Water F, Sewer Department, and Arkansas Western
Gas were not available at this time.
There was no further discussion.
The meeting was adjourned at 9:50 A.M.
